The Lanternbox uploader strips EXIF metadata before any image reaches shared storage. New folks should know the scrubber runs in-process, so we cap image dimensions and per-file time budgets to keep p95 latency sane. Files over the size ceiling are routed to the async path instead. GPS tags are always removed; orientation is preserved and re-baked. These limits were chosen after profiling on the Marwick staging cluster. The constants we currently ship with are:

tuning table, yajog-yahof:
BUDGETS = {
    "lamvan": 303,
    "wenox": 460,
    "fenvan": 525,
}

Handover: report export timezones — Fennick Analytics

All exports from Reportsmith store timestamps in UTC; conversion happens at render using the workspace timezone, not the user's. Last week's bug: scheduled exports ignored DST transitions. Patch deployed; watch the export-drift metric through Sunday. If drift alerts fire, roll back the scheduler only, not the renderer. Full context and rollback steps are on the internal incident page.

runbook for badug-kadup: https://confluence.zemvarlabs.internal/projects/browse/display/projects/bd1b

# Artifact Signing — Fernwick Cache Team

Fernwick puts a bloom filter in front of the Tansel key-value store to skip misses before they hit disk. The filter binary ships as a signed artifact; unsigned builds are rejected by the Dovelet deploy gate. Rebuild the filter whenever keyspace grows past 80% of sizing, then sign and publish. New members: never regenerate keys locally — use the team vault copy only. Sign every artifact with the deploy key that follows.

rollout seal: bky3_bf1

Quick heads-up: we're switching from Harwick Freight to Bluepine Logistics at the end of next month. Bluepine offers better lane coverage to our Eastmoor depot and roughly 12% lower per-pallet rates. Expect a two-week overlap while contracts wind down — flag any urgent shipments to your ops contact early. Packaging specs stay the same; labels change slightly, templates coming soon. Thanks for bearing with the transition. One confidential item for this group follows below.

board note of tadup-tajog: Headcount on the Oliiel team goes from 31 to 88 by the end of February. Gross margin on Oliiel came in at 62 percent against a plan of 29 percent.